To catch up with Google, Microsoft and Sun cooperation

In order to increase the flow of Internet search, Microsoft has old rival Sun Microsystems for help, Sun hopes for Microsoft to provide search marketing help.

According to the two companies announced Monday the agreement, Sun will promote users of Microsoft's IE browser toolbar, is when users download Sun Java software prompts the user. Some sites use Java software must be able to watch. Microsoft's IE toolbar has a Live Search query dialog box, and allows users to view the content of the MSN tool button.

Microsoft's Live Search group, senior director of Norton said: "We need to provide advertisers with more content." From the search market, Microsoft's search traffic ranking third with Google and Yahoo have a big gap. Microsoft has been trying to search for ways to improve the flow, and strive to change the unfavorable situation in the third.

Sun and Microsoft have in many ways been the fierce competition. Microsoft in the long-term anti-trust lawsuit, Sun was one of the most well-known opponent. In 2004, Sun patents through mediation and anti-monopoly Microsoft had nearly 20 billion dollars in compensation.

Sun and Microsoft did not disclose aspects of the new cooperation agreement the two sides of the duration and financial details. Sun is currently grappling difficult, the company's quarterly loss of 17 million.

The two sides in accordance with an agreement to install Java software, computer users can also get dialog MSN toolbar. Sun in the past with Yahoo and Google have the same agreement.

Microsoft abandoned its offer to buy Yahoo, Microsoft has vowed to invest its own search technology and not hesitate to spend money on the cost of the signing of the contract goal is to attract more users to use Microsoft's search. At present, the most influential of the contract is the beginning of January this year, Microsoft and Hewlett-Packard agreement. The agreement provides for the North American market in the Hewlett-Packard's PC sales will be pre-installed Microsoft's search engine. Hewlett-Packard computers are installed in the browser toolbar.

Microsoft executives said that Microsoft will focus on the browser toolbar and default configuration of the machine, because 35% of the search through the browser address bar, built-in search box and toolbar plug-in operation, while others Search through the service provider's page.
